Facts about The Rain

Who wrote The Rain lyrics?


The Rain is written by Carlene Carter, Bernie Taupin.

When was The Rain released?


The Rain is first released on June 22, 1993 as part of Carlene Carter's album "Little Love Letters" which includes 14 tracks in total. This song is the 12nd track on this album.

Which genre is The Rain?


The Rain falls under the genre Country.
